#3dcfc0 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#3dcfc0 is composed of 23.9% red, 81.2% green and 75.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 70.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 7.2% yellow and 18.8% black. It has a hue angle of 173.8 degrees, a saturation of 60.3% and a lightness of 52.5%. #3dcfc0 color hex could be obtained by blending #7affff with #009f81. Closest websafe color is: #33cccc.

Shades and Tints of #3dcfc0

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030a0a is the darkest color, while #fafefd is the lightest one.

Tones of #3dcfc0

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7e8e8c is the less saturated color, while #0efee5 is the most saturated one.
